SPICE 1000/Mk 83 guided-bomb configuration

Rafael's SPICE 1000/Mk 83 guided-bomb configuration turns 1,000-pound Mk 83-series bombs into stand-off precision weapons. The Israeli Air Force has documented use of the configuration in Gaza during the Israel-Hamas War.

Specifications

Warhead class
1,000 lb Mk 83-series
Guidance
EO seeker with scene-matching guidance and GPS-denied operation
Range
Up to 125 km
Accuracy
About 3 m CEP

Yemen Civil War
Side: IsraelRole: Long-range precision strike against Houthi targetsprecision firesdeep strikestrike

Fielded by the Israeli Air Force during Red Sea escalation strikes in Yemen, with IDF imagery reviewed by TWZ showing F-15C/D aircraft loaded with SPICE 1000 glide bombs for attacks on Houthi targets.
